I found an old thread which indicated that Weinmann machines should come with software on CD to allow some degree of monitoring. However when I looked at the Weinmann website it appears the software is just for medical practitioners and is not available to end users. I was able to find the following entries in the catalogue:

WM 24748 CD-Rom with instructions for use for hospital staff BiLevel ST 22 (only for medical and technical personnel)

WM 93305 WEINMANNsupport - PC Software for setting and analysis of WEINMANN ventilation and sleep therapy devices with converter cable USB-RS/485 consists of:
- WEINMANNsupport, PC Software (WM 93301)
- Converter cable USB-RS/485, complete (WM 93321)


WM 93301 WEINMANNsupport, PC software *free of charge as update, otherwise as part of Set WM93305

I don't think SleepyHead supports Weinmann machines, but perhaps one of the members with more detailed knowledge could confirm that.

unfortunately the software PrismaTS for the Prisma 20 seems not available for end users, at least in germany.

I have tried different ways to get it. I wrote directly to Weinmann and have then tried to get it through the Heinen and Löwenstein distribution and my doctor, with no success.

So I'm starting to try it by myself and maybe get it to work with SleepyHead.

The therapy.pdat though is a normal zip file which contains amongst other things binary data that seems to hold the signal-stream of the night (mnt/flash/data/therapy/signals/20160730/signal_000093.wmedf) and data of the daily statistics in text form (mnt/flash/data/statistics/statistics_year.bin).

I think to break down the signal data itself is nearly impossible and unfortunately even the text data are not very intuitive (the only data I figured out at the moment is the start time and duration of the recordings), but I think it should possible.
